Understanding Credit Card Rewards Programs

Understanding credit card rewards programs can significantly enhance your financial benefits and spending habits. These programs allow consumers to earn points, cash back, or travel miles for every dollar spent using their credit cards. Each program has its unique structure, with categories that may reward specific types of purchases, such as groceries, gas, or travel. To maximize your rewards, it's essential to choose a card that aligns with your spending patterns and lifestyle. Additionally, be mindful of the program's terms, including expiration dates on points and potential fees. By strategically using your card and understanding the intricacies of the rewards system, you can enjoy significant savings and perks.

Recognizing the Importance of APR and Fees

Understanding the significance of Annual Percentage Rate (APR) and associated fees is crucial for anyone navigating financial decisions, particularly in borrowing scenarios such as loans and credit cards. The APR provides a clearer picture of the true cost of borrowing, as it encompasses the interest rate along with any additional fees that may be charged throughout the loan term. This comprehensive view enables consumers to compare different financial products effectively, ensuring they make informed choices. Overlooking these factors can lead to unexpected financial burdens. Therefore, recognizing the importance of APR and fees empowers individuals to manage their finances wisely and avoid falling into debt traps.
